Cpap Problems - Surely There Must Be A Better Way!


Having sleep apnea presents several health problems. It robs you of healthy sleep, wakes you a number of times a night and could very well even be the reason for other damaging health conditions. Oh, and it doesn't do much for your marriage either.

The standard doctor prescribed treatment for sleep apnea is the Cpap . This device guarantees a measured flow of oxygen into the lungs the whole night through. This immediately has the effect of better quality sleep and consequently, a lot more energy during the day. For certain fortunate folk, this device is a godsend and the answer to all their problems. Many others are left wondering if the cure is worse than the disease itself.

Cpap problems can appear to be insurmountable and there are a few individuals who never become reconciled with their machine, in spite of how much they want to. They know that using it will be good for their wellbeing, but this must be balanced with the fact that they simply are not able to go to sleep whilst wearing the thing.

The primary reason many people find it difficult to sleep while using the machine is probably due to the initial discomfort. Some people find the mask gives them a sense of claustrophobia. This is so real for some individuals that they start breathing rapidly and find that they're on the brink of a panic attack. Certainly not the type of situation you are looking for when trying to fall asleep.

Some others find the feeling of the mask on their face quite uncomfortable mainly when the weather is hot. Sweat which forms under the mask can bring about skin conditions such as rashes or acne. The latex liner that presses against the face is infamous for causing skin allergies as a result.

The recommended sleep position for anyone who is wearing Cpap is flat on your back. Turning over on to your side using the mask is fraught with difficulty. There is invariably the possibility of your pillow knocking the mask thereby breaking the seal, allowing air to leak out. There are specially designed pillows, however, which can help this situation. So the only other thing to worry about now is becoming tangled in the hose.

Additional well-known Cpap problems include nasal congestion and therefore breathing through the mouth. Decongestants can be used to clear nasal passages, although these can result in dependence. Even worse, striving to deal with cold and flu symptoms while wearing this machine is tricky to say the least. Nasal sprays and humidifiers may help a bit. Anything at all which eases congestion, for example saline sprays may help too.
